Description
[(4R)-4,5-Dihydro-4-(1-Methylethyl)-2-Oxazolyl]-Ferrocene is a chiral, organometallic compound featuring a ferrocene core modified with a substituted oxazoline ligand. This unique structure makes it a highly valuable ligand precursor and chiral building block for asymmetric synthesis and catalysis. It is primarily utilized by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and fine chemical industries to develop novel synthetic pathways and enhance stereoselectivity.
Application
- Asymmetric Catalysis: Serves as a precursor for chiral ligands in transition metal-catalyzed reactions, including hydrogenation, cross-coupling, and cycloaddition.
- Pharmaceutical Intermediate: Used in the research and development of active pharmaceutical ingredients (APIs) requiring high enantiomeric purity.
- Agrochemical Synthesis: Employed as a chiral synthon in the production of advanced, stereospecific pesticides and herbicides.
- Material Science Research: Investigated for the development of novel organometallic complexes with unique electronic or magnetic properties.
- Academic & Industrial R&D: A key reagent for methodological studies in organic and organometallic chemistry for discovering new catalytic systems.
Basic Information
| Product Name | [(4R)-4,5-Dihydro-4-(1-Methylethyl)-2-Oxazolyl]-Ferrocene |
| CAS No. | 2757082-13-4 |
| Molecular Formula | C16H19FeNO |
| Molecular Weight | 297.18 g/mol |
| Synonyms | (R)-4-Isopropyl-2-ferrocenyl-4,5-dihydrooxazole; (R)-4-Isopropyl-2-ferrocenyl-2-oxazoline; Ferrocenyloxazoline Ligand Precursor; (R)-Fc-iPrOX; (4R)-4-(1-Methylethyl)-2-ferrocenyl-4,5-dihydrooxazole; (R)-2-Ferrocenyl-4-isopropyl-4,5-dihydrooxazole |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ive); keep the container tightly sealed under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ent degradation.
